Here is part 2 of my selected keyboard shortcuts. For a complete list of all shortcuts, please visit this Microsoft Web page. Happy testing! ALT+TAB = switch between running programs (windows in taskbar) ALT+F4 = close running program or window ALT+down arrow = open drop down list box ALT+ENTER = open properties for the selected object F1 = help [...]

Windows Vista System Restore error »

When you try to restore Windows Vista to an earlier date, you get the following error message: “vss error, volume shadow copy service error instantiating vss server. Error 0×80070422″. This message, although it looks like it’s a Windows Update error (judging by the error code), is caused by the absence of the Volume Shadow Copy service. To [...]
